Halloween Party

Wow, what a great evening we had for the Halloween Party. As you walked in you could tell that it was going to be a great night. The evening began with George teaching the group class, the dance was Swing. From the start of the class there were at least 50 people. They continued to arrive as the class went on.

I really enjoy the spirit of Halloween and have fun putting up the decorations. As those in attendance can verify, there were a lot of decorations. There was a mural that spanned the entire length of the mirrors and there were many suspended ghouls and witches.

The dance party began at 9:00pm as usual, thank goodness we had plenty of food and beverage on hand because everyone came with a big appetite. We weren’t serving a meal, but they all ate like they expected one. We had cheeses, fruits, veggies, chips, sandwiches, and desserts, as well as beverages.

Everyone seemed to really enjoy the show. We encourage the performers at this party to wear Halloween costumes to help everyone feel the mood of the dance. We saw the “Spooky” Cha-Cha, Insane in the Brain dance and “Dracula” Tango. The group numbers were The Addams Family and Thriller. The solos were very good and the group numbers were great! Lighting effects and costuming really add something special to the show numbers.

After the show, everyone continued dancing all night long, literally. We let the dancers continue dancing until midnight. The fun just wouldn’t stop. Don’t miss next year’s Halloween party.
